What Exactly Are Non GamStop Casinos?

Non GamStop casinos operate outside the UK Gambling Commission’s licensing system. They aren’t connected to the national self-exclusion programme, which means they don’t automatically block players who’ve signed up to GamStop. Instead, these sites hold international licences – often from Curacao, Malta, or Gibraltar – and they tend to offer a very different kind of experience.

The Real Drawbacks You Should Know

It’s not all upside. Non GamStop casinos come with real trade-offs. Reduced regulatory protection means you’re relying on the licensing authority’s dispute process, which can be slower and less consumer-friendly than the UKGC’s. Responsible gambling tools also vary wildly between operators – some offer excellent controls, others barely anything. Before registering, you should always verify the licence, payment methods, bonus conditions, and customer support quality. Choosing a licensed and reputable operator is the single most important factor.
